JSON-модели
Некоторые модели JSON для API Problems v2 различаются в зависимости от типа модели. Модели JSON для каждого варианта перечислены ниже.
Вариации Evidence
объекта
Объект Evidence
является основой для доказательства проблемы. Фактический набор полей зависит от типа свидетельства.
ДОСТУПНОСТЬ_EVIDENCE
ДоступностьДоказательстваМетаданные
Объект _ AvailabilityEvidence
Доказательство первопричины.
Фактический набор полей зависит от типа свидетельства. Найдите список актуальных объектов в описании поляvideType или посмотрите модели Problems API v2-JSON .
Элемент | Тип | Описание |
---|---|---|
время окончания | целое число | Время окончания свидетельства в миллисекундах UTC. |
МЕРОПРИЯТИЕ
EventEvidenceMetadata
Объект _ EventEvidence
Доказательство первопричины.
Фактический набор полей зависит от типа свидетельства. Найдите список актуальных объектов в описании поляvideType или посмотрите модели Problems API v2-JSON .
Элемент | Тип | Описание |
---|---|---|
идентификатор события | нить | Идентификатор события. |
данные | Мероприятие | Конфигурация события. |
тип события | нить | Тип события. |
время окончания | целое число | Отметка времени окончания события в миллисекундах UTC.
Имеет |
Объект _ Event
Конфигурация события.
Элемент | Тип | Описание |
---|---|---|
частособытие | логический | Если true , событие происходит часто .
Частое событие не вызывает проблем. |
подавлятьпроблему | логический | Статус обнаружения проблемы во время технического обслуживания :
|
подавлять оповещение | логический | Состояние предупреждения во время технического обслуживания :
|
на техобслуживании | логический | Если true , событие произошло, когда отслеживаемая система находилась на обслуживании.
|
управлениеЗоны | Зона управления [] | Список всех зон управления, которым принадлежит событие. |
идентификатор сущности | Заглушка сущности | Краткое представление отслеживаемого объекта. |
идентификатор события | нить | Идентификатор события. |
сущностьТеги | М Е тег [] | Список тегов связанного объекта. |
тип события | нить | Тип события. |
характеристики | Свойство события [] | Список свойств события. |
статус | нить | Статус события.
Элемент может содержать эти значения
|
время начала | целое число | Отметка времени возникновения события в миллисекундах UTC. |
время окончания | целое число | Отметка времени закрытия события в миллисекундах UTC.
Имеет значение, |
заглавие | нить | Название события. |
идентификатор корреляции | нить | Идентификатор корреляции события. |
Объект _ ManagementZone
Краткое представление зоны управления.
Элемент | Тип | Описание |
---|---|---|
имя | нить | Имя зоны управления. |
я бы | нить | Идентификатор зоны управления. |
Объект _ EntityStub
Краткое представление отслеживаемого объекта.
Элемент | Тип | Описание |
---|---|---|
идентификатор сущности | Идентификатор объекта | Краткое представление отслеживаемого объекта. |
имя | нить | Имя сущности.
Не включается в ответ, если сущность с соответствующим идентификатором не найдена. |
Объект _ EntityId
Краткое представление отслеживаемого объекта.
Элемент | Тип | Описание |
---|---|---|
я бы | нить | Идентификатор сущности. |
тип | нить | Тип сущности. |
Объект _ METag
Тег отслеживаемого объекта.
Элемент | Тип | Описание |
---|---|---|
представление строки | нить | Строковое представление тега. |
ценность | нить | Значение тега. |
ключ | нить | Ключ тега. |
контекст | нить | Происхождение тега, например AWS или Cloud Foundry.
Пользовательские теги используют это |
Объект _ EventProperty
Свойство события.
Элемент | Тип | Описание |
---|---|---|
ценность | нить | Значение свойства события. |
ключ | нить | Ключ свойства события. |
MAINTENANCE_WINDOW
Метаданные MaintenanceWindowEvidence
Объект _ MaintenanceWindowEvidence
Доказательство первопричины.
Фактический набор полей зависит от типа свидетельства. Найдите список актуальных объектов в описании поляvideType или посмотрите модели Problems API v2-JSON .
Элемент | Тип | Описание |
---|---|---|
техническое обслуживаниеWindowConfigId | нить | Идентификатор соответствующего периода обслуживания. |
время окончания | целое число | Время окончания свидетельства в миллисекундах UTC. |
МЕТРИЧЕСКАЯ
MetricEvidenceMetadata
Объект _ MetricEvidence
Доказательство первопричины.
Фактический набор полей зависит от типа свидетельства. Найдите список актуальных объектов в описании поляvideType или посмотрите модели Problems API v2-JSON .
Элемент | Тип | Описание |
---|---|---|
значениеBeforeChangePoint | количество | Значение метрики до возникновения проблемы. |
значениеАфтерчанжепоинт | количество | Значение метрики после начала проблемы. |
идентификатор метрики | нить | Идентификатор метрики. |
время окончания | целое число | Время окончания свидетельства в миллисекундах UTC.
Значение |
Ед. изм | нить | Единица измерения.
Элемент может содержать эти значения
|
ТРАНЗАКЦИОННЫЙ
TransactionalEvidenceMetadata
Объект _ TransactionalEvidence
Доказательство первопричины.
Фактический набор полей зависит от типа свидетельства. Найдите список актуальных объектов в описании поляvideType или посмотрите модели Problems API v2-JSON .
Элемент | Тип | Описание |
---|---|---|
значениеBeforeChangePoint | количество | Значение метрики до возникновения проблемы. |
значениеАфтерчанжепоинт | количество | Значение метрики после начала проблемы. |
время окончания | целое число | Время окончания свидетельства, в миллисекундах UTC |
Ед. изм | нить | Единица измерения. |
Вариации Impact
объекта
Объект Impact
является базой для воздействия проблемы. Фактический набор полей зависит от типа воздействия.
ЗАЯВЛЕНИЕ
ApplicationImpactDto
Объект _ ApplicationImpact
Анализ воздействия проблемы на другие объекты/пользователей.
Фактический набор полей зависит от типа воздействия. Найдите список актуальных объектов в описании поля ImpactType или посмотрите модели Problems API v2-JSON .
Элемент | Тип | Описание |
---|---|---|
ударТип | нить | Определяет фактический набор полей в зависимости от значения. См. один из следующих объектов:
Элемент может содержать эти значения
|
воздействующий объект | Заглушка сущности | Краткое представление отслеживаемого объекта. |
предполагаемые затронутые пользователи | целое число | Предполагаемое количество затронутых пользователей. |
Объект _ EntityStub
Краткое представление отслеживаемого объекта.
Элемент | Тип | Описание |
---|---|---|
идентификатор сущности | Идентификатор объекта | Краткое представление отслеживаемого объекта. |
имя | нить | Имя сущности.
Не включается в ответ, если сущность с соответствующим идентификатором не найдена. |
Объект _ EntityId
Краткое представление отслеживаемого объекта.
Элемент | Тип | Описание |
---|---|---|
я бы | нить | Идентификатор сущности. |
тип | нить | Тип сущности. |
CUSTOM_APPLICATION
CustomApplicationImpactDto
Объект _ CustomApplicationImpact
Анализ воздействия проблемы на другие объекты/пользователей.
Фактический набор полей зависит от типа воздействия. Найдите список актуальных объектов в описании поля ImpactType или посмотрите модели Problems API v2-JSON .
Элемент | Тип | Описание |
---|---|---|
ударТип | нить | Определяет фактический набор полей в зависимости от значения. См. один из следующих объектов:
Элемент может содержать эти значения
|
воздействующий объект | Заглушка сущности | Краткое представление отслеживаемого объекта. |
предполагаемые затронутые пользователи | целое число | Предполагаемое количество затронутых пользователей. |
Объект _ EntityStub
Краткое представление отслеживаемого объекта.
Элемент | Тип | Описание |
---|---|---|
идентификатор сущности | Идентификатор объекта | Краткое представление отслеживаемого объекта. |
имя | нить | Имя сущности.
Не включается в ответ, если сущность с соответствующим идентификатором не найдена. |
Объект _ EntityId
Краткое представление отслеживаемого объекта.
Элемент | Тип | Описание |
---|---|---|
я бы | нить | Идентификатор сущности. |
тип | нить | Тип сущности. |
МОБИЛЬНЫЙ
MobileImpactDto
Объект _ MobileImpact
Анализ воздействия проблемы на другие объекты/пользователей.
Фактический набор полей зависит от типа воздействия. Найдите список актуальных объектов в описании поля ImpactType или посмотрите модели Problems API v2-JSON .
Элемент | Тип | Описание |
---|---|---|
ударТип | нить | Определяет фактический набор полей в зависимости от значения. См. один из следующих объектов:
Элемент может содержать эти значения
|
воздействующий объект | Заглушка сущности | Краткое представление отслеживаемого объекта. |
предполагаемые затронутые пользователи | целое число | Предполагаемое количество затронутых пользователей. |
Объект _ EntityStub
Краткое представление отслеживаемого объекта.
Элемент | Тип | Описание |
---|---|---|
идентификатор сущности | Идентификатор объекта | Краткое представление отслеживаемого объекта. |
имя | нить | Имя сущности.
Не включается в ответ, если сущность с соответствующим идентификатором не найдена. |
Объект _ EntityId
Краткое представление отслеживаемого объекта.
Элемент | Тип | Описание |
---|---|---|
я бы | нить | Идентификатор сущности. |
тип | нить | Тип сущности. |
ОКАЗАНИЕ УСЛУГ
ServiceImpactDto
Объект _ ServiceImpact
Анализ воздействия проблемы на другие объекты/пользователей.
Фактический набор полей зависит от типа воздействия. Найдите список актуальных объектов в описании поля ImpactType или посмотрите модели Problems API v2-JSON .
Элемент | Тип | Описание |
---|---|---|
numberOfPotentiallyAffectedServiceCalls | целое число | Количество потенциально затронутых сервисов. |